4 Ways to Boost Attention Intelligence (AQ) in the Workplace

KnowledgeCity

University of California, Irving professor Gloria Mark indicates that it takes more than 23 minutes on average to regain concentration following an interruption. Applications like email, Facebook, Slack and LinkedIn all pressure users to push notifications to facilitate immediacy in communication. Regulate Notifications.

Digital Badges for Educational Achievement

Web Courseworks

The Mozilla Foundation launched its Open Badges project in September 2011. Higher-ed institutions like Purdue and the University of California–Davis are offering badges alongside their courses and degrees to help students further differentiate themselves. Anyone with an email address can sign up for their own backpack.
